Historic LoDo: Stephen Bodio, one of the foremost author/naturalists in the country, will discuss and sign his new book An Eternity of Eagles: The Human History of the Most Fascinating Bird in the World (Lyons Press), a lavishly illustrated natural and social history of the eagle.Bodio,
a traveler who writes about hunting and nature, delivers a beautiful
follow-up to his book about his travels with the hunters of Mongolia, Eagle Dreams
with paintings by such artists as John
James Audubon, Louis Agassiz Fuertes, Emil Doepler and especially the
Russian Vadim Gorbatov, whose paintings and color photography of Kazakh
and Mongolian eagle-falconers add another dimension to the narrative and
complement the author's own photography. His beautiful natural and
social history of the most beautiful bird in the world—the
eagle—includes a lengthy introduction by Annie Proulx.

Colfax Avenue: Two acclaimed young adult authors will join us for an evening of fantastical fiction. Maggie Stiefvater, author of the New York Times bestselling Shiver trilogy and The Scorpio Races, will read from and sign Raven Boys (Scholastic), the first book in a spellbinding new series. It is freezing in the churchyard. Every
year, Blue Sargent stands next to her clairvoyant mother as the
soon-to-be dead walk past. Blue herself never sees them—not until this
year, when a boy emerges from the dark and speaks directly to her.
